WebClyde was Clint Eastwood's sidekick in the box office hit Every Which Way But Loose & its sequel, Any Which Way You Can.He was a trained orangutan played by three different animals in the two movies. In the first movie, he was played by Manis.By the time for the sequel, Manis had grown too big & two other orangutans (C. J. & Buddha) shared the part. Are Philo and Orville brothers? inclined plane and wedgeManis was a trained orangutan that played Clyde as Clint Eastwood's sidekick in the 1978 box office hit Every Which Way But Loose. Its 1980 sequel, Any Which Way You Can (1980), did not feature Manis, as the "child actor" had grown too much between productions. In the sequel, two orangutans, C.J. and Buddha, shared the role.
